Navicat for MySQL数据库编辑工具使用指南

需积分: 5 0 下载量 70 浏览量 更新于2024-11-19 收藏 40.76MB ZIP 举报
资源摘要信息:"Navicat for MySQL 是一款功能强大的数据库管理和开发工具,适用于 MySQL、MariaDB、SQL Azure、Oracle 等数据库系统。该软件能够帮助用户方便地进行数据库设计、查询、维护和开发工作。通过 Navicat for MySQL,用户可以执行 SQL 脚本,导入导出数据,以及管理数据库对象如表、视图、索引、触发器等。" 知识点详细说明: 1. Navicat for MySQL 概述 Navicat for MySQL 是一款流行的企业级数据库管理工具,专为数据库管理员、开发人员和数据分析师而设计。它提供了一个直观且功能丰富的界面,使用户能够高效地管理 MySQL 数据库。它集成了数据库设计、数据迁移、数据同步、报告等多种功能,旨在简化数据库的创建、维护和故障排除过程。 2. 数据库连接管理 用户可以使用 Navicat for MySQL 连接到本地或远程的 MySQL 数据库服务器。该软件提供了清晰的步骤,指导用户完成连接设置过程,包括输入主机地址、端口号、用户名和密码等信息。连接一旦建立,用户可以进行各种数据库操作,如查询执行、数据编辑、对象管理等。 3. SQL 文件导入导出 标题中提到的“导入后缀名为sql文件”,指的是 Navicat for MySQL 提供的 SQL 文件导入导出功能。用户可以将现有的 SQL 文件导入到数据库中,这个 SQL 文件通常包含了创建表、插入数据、更新表结构等 SQL 语句。相对应地,也可以将数据库中的数据或对象结构导出为 SQL 文件,用于备份或迁移到其他数据库。 4. 编辑数据库 描述中提到的“对数据库进行编辑”,意味着用户可以在 Navicat for MySQL 中直接对数据库中的数据进行查询、插入、更新或删除操作。它提供了图形化的界面,用户可以通过表格视图进行数据的直观编辑,也可以直接编写 SQL 语句来完成复杂的操作。 5. MySQL 数据库 MySQL 是一个开源的关系型数据库管理系统,广泛应用于网站和应用程序的后端。它以其高性能、高可靠性和易用性著称。MySQL 的灵活性和扩展性使其成为小型到大型应用的理想选择。Navicat for MySQL 作为支持 MySQL 的工具之一,能够很好地与 MySQL 数据库兼容,提供高效的数据库管理和开发能力。 6. SQL 语言基础 SQL(结构化查询语言)是用于访问和处理数据库的标准编程语言。它被设计用来执行各种操作,比如查询数据库中的数据、更新和修改数据、创建新表、更改数据库结构、控制数据访问权限等。了解和熟练掌握 SQL 是进行数据库操作的基础。在 Navicat for MySQL 中,SQL 编辑器是用户执行 SQL 查询和命令的重要界面。 7. 数据库对象管理 Navicat for MySQL 支持对数据库中的各种对象进行管理,如表、视图、索引、存储过程、触发器等。用户可以创建、修改和删除这些对象,以适应业务需求的变化。例如,用户可以创建新表来存储数据,或者通过索引来加快查询速度。 8. 数据库设计和模型化 使用 Navicat for MySQL,用户可以设计和构建数据库模型,帮助他们以图形化的方式理解数据库结构。该功能允许用户创建表、设置字段属性,并直观地展示表与表之间的关系。数据库设计工具使数据库架构的创建和优化变得简单高效。 通过上述的详细说明,我们可以了解到 Navicat for MySQL 是一款强大的数据库管理工具,它涵盖了数据库连接管理、SQL 文件导入导出、数据库编辑、MySQL 数据库操作以及 SQL 语言基础等多个方面的知识。